Pennslyvania Masonic Youth Foundation is located in Elizabethtown, PA. The organization was established in 1987.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Pennslyvania Masonic Youth Foundation is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
For the year ending 12/2022, Pennslyvania Masonic Youth Foundation generated $1.4m in total revenue. The organization has seen a slow decline revenue. Over the past 8 years, revenues have fallen by an average of (2.8%) each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$1.2m during the year ending 12/2022. Describe the Organization's Mission:
Part 3 - Line 1
THE MISSION OF THE PENNSYLVANIA MASONIC YOUTH FOUNDATION IS TO LEAD THE MASONIC FRATERNITY IN PROVIDING SERVICES ON BEHALF OF YOUNG PEOPLE, AND TRAINING FOR ADULTS WHO WORK FOR THE BETTERMENT OF YOUTH.
Describe the Organization's Program Activity:
Part 3 - Line 4a
1. SUPPORTED 1,455 MEMBERS OF THE PENNSYLVANIA AFFILIATES OF THE FOLLOWING MASONIC YOUTH GROUPS: DEMOLAY, JOB'S DAUGHTERS, KNIGHTS OF PYTHAGORAS, RAINBOW, AND RUTH MITCHELL TUCKER GIRLS YOUTH DEPARTMENT. 2. AWARDED SCHOLARSHIPS TOTALING 205,250 TO STUDENTS WHO ATTEND OR WILL ATTEND HIGHER EDUCATION INSTITUTIONS. 3. TRAINED TEACHERS, COUNSELORS, ADMINISTRATORS AND YOUTH SERVICE PROFESSIONALS AT VIRTUAL AND IN-PERSON EDUCATIONAL INSTITUTE WORKSHOPS. 4. PUBLISHED AND DISTRIBUTED NUMEROUS NEWSLETTERS, BOOKLETS, DIRECTORIES, PROGRAM FLYERS, BROCHURES, AND GUIDEBOOKS FOR VARIOUS YOUTH PROGRAMS AND ADULT VOLUNTEERS. 5. FUNDED THE ENTIRE COST OF COMPREHENSIVE CRIMINAL BACKGROUND CHECKS AND ADULT WORKER PROFILES FOR ALL MASONIC YOUTH ORGANIZATION ADULT VOLUNTEERS. 6. GRANTED 34,778 TO YOUTH-LED SERVICE PROJECTS THROUGHOUT THE COMMONWEALTH OF PENNSYLVANIA. 7. CONTINUE TO MAINTAIN THE INTERNET SITES OF THE FOUNDATION (WWW.PMYF.ORG), RAINBOW (WWW.PARAINBOWGIRLS.ORG), AND DEMOLAY (WWW.PADEMOLAY.ORG), AND PROVIDED TECHNICAL ASSISTANCE TO JOB'S DAUGHTERS (WWW.PAIOJD.ORG).
